Расчет доли: сколько процентов составляет число от другого числа в Экселе

Определение того, сколько процентов составляет число от другого числа в Экселе, требует выполнения базового математического действия деления с последующим изменением формата ячейки. Пользователь вводит исходные данные в две разные ячейки, например, A1 и B1, где хранится часть и целое соответственно, а в третьей ячейке прописывает формулу со знаком равенства, указывая адрес делимого и делителя.

После нажатия клавиши Enter программа отображает десятичную дробь, которая визуально не соответствует ожидаемому процентному значению до применения специального форматирования. Для корректного отображения результата необходимо выделить ячейку с формулой и выбрать в меню «Главная» группу «Число», где расположен значок процента или выпадающий список с соответствующим вариантом.

Этот метод является универсальным для всех версий табличного процессора Microsoft Excel, начиная с ранних релизов 2007 года и заканчивая современными облачными подписками Microsoft 365. Понимание принципа работы относительных ссылок позволяет масштабировать расчет на тысячи строк данных без необходимости ручного ввода формулы для каждой позиции отдельно.

Базовая формула для вычисления доли

Фундаментальный принцип расчета в электронных таблицах строится на простом математическом соотношении: часть делится на целое. В синтаксисе программы это выражается через оператор деления /. Если вам нужно узнать, какую долю составляет сумма 50 от общей суммы 200, вы вводите в ячейку выражение =50/200, что дает результат 0,25.

Для работы с динамическими данными, которые могут меняться, использование жестко заданных чисел неэффективно. Профессионалы предпочитают ссылаться на адреса ячеек, где хранятся значения. Например, если в ячейке A2 записана проданная единица товара, а в B2 — общий план продаж, формула примет вид =A2/B2.

Если перепутать делимое и делитель, вы получите значение, показывающее, во сколько раз одно число больше другого, а не его процентную долю. Всегда делите часть на целое, чтобы получить корректную долю единицы.

  • 📊 Используйте абсолютные ссылки со знаком доллара $, если знаменатель (целое число) фиксирован для всех строк таблицы.
  • 🔢 Увеличивайте разрядность дробей кнопкой «Увеличить разрядность», если видите округленные значения вроде 15% вместо 15,34%.
  • 📝 Проверяйте, что в исходных ячейках не содержатся текстовые символы, которые могут привести к ошибке #ЗНАЧ! при вычислениях.

⚠️ Внимание: Если в ячейке с целым числом (делителем) стоит ноль, формула вернет ошибку #ДЕЛ/0!. Это означает, что деление на ноль математически невозможно, и программу требуется защитить проверкой условий.

Преобразование результата в процентный формат

Получив десятичную дробь в результате деления, пользователь часто ошибочно полагает, что расчет выполнен неверно, так как видит 0,15 вместо 15%. Программа Excel по умолчанию отображает числа в общем числовом формате, поэтому требуется явное указание типа данных. Для этого служит кнопка «Процентный формат» на панели инструментов или горячие клавиши Ctrl+Shift+%.

При применении процентного формата программа автоматически умножает отображаемое значение на 100 и добавляет символ процента. Важно понимать, что внутреннее значение ячейки остается десятичной дробью, меняется только её визуальное представление. Это позволяет использовать результат в дальнейших математических операциях без искажений.

Если автоматическое форматирование не применилось, можно воспользоваться диалоговым окном «Формат ячеек», вызываемым по клику правой кнопкой мыши. В категории «Числовой» или «Процентный» можно задать точное количество знаков после запятой, что особенно важно для финансовой отчетности, где требуется высокая точность вычислений.

Почему 0,15 превращается в 15%?

Внутренний механизм Excel хранит даты как целые числа, а время и проценты как дроби от единицы. 100% равно 1, 50% равно 0,5. Форматирование лишь меняет «маску» отображения, умножая число на 100 для удобства чтения человеком.

Существует альтернативный способ получения процентов сразу при вводе формулы. Если к выражению деления добавить умножение на 100 и вручную вписать знак процента, например =A2/B2*100&"%", результат станет текстовой строкой. Такой подход не рекомендуется для дальнейших расчетов, так как текст нельзя использовать в математических формулах.

Работа с абсолютными и относительными ссылками

При копировании формулы вниз по столбцу адреса ячеек изменяются автоматически, что называется относительной ссылкой. Это удобно, когда и числитель, и знаменатель сдвигаются параллельно. Однако часто встречается ситуация, когда знаменатель (общее число) зафиксировано в одной ячейке, например, C1, а делимые значения расположены в столбце A.

Чтобы при протягивании формулы ссылка на общее число не «уехала» на C2, C3 и так далее, необходимо использовать абсолютную адресацию. Для этого перед буквой столбца и номером строки ставится знак доллара $. Формула будет выглядеть как =A2/$C$1. Знак доллара «замораживает» адрес, делая его постоянным при копировании.

Использование смешанных ссылок, где зафиксирован только столбец или только строка, позволяет создавать сложные таблицы перекрестных вычислений. Например, ссылка $A2 позволит копировать формулу вправо, сохраняя ссылку на столбец A, но меняя строку при движении вниз. Это мощный инструмент для построения матриц расчетов.

☑️ Проверка ссылок перед расчетом

Выполнено: 0 / 1

Обработка ошибок и нестандартных ситуаций

В реальных таблицах данные часто бывают неидеальными: встречаются пустые ячейки, текстовые пометки или нулевые значения. Стандартная формула деления в таких случаях выдает ошибки #ДЕЛ/0! или #ЗНАЧ!, что портит вид отчета и может ломать суммирование столбца. Для предотвращения этого используется функция ЕСЛИОШИБКА.

Обернув основную формулу в проверку, можно заставить программу выводить ноль, прочерк или пустую строку вместо кода ошибки. Синтаксис выглядит так: =ЕСЛИОШИБКА(A2/B2; 0). В этом случае, если деление на ноль невозможно, в ячейке отобразится 0, и таблица останется чистой.

Еще одной частой проблемой является наличие скрытых символов или пробелов в ячейках с числами, которые программа воспринимает как текст. Визуально ячейка может выглядеть как число, но выравнивание по левому краю и зеленый треугольник в углу укажут на проблему. Перед расчетом процентов такие данные необходимо очистить с помощью функции ЗНАЧЕН или инструмента «Текст по столбцам».

Тип ошибки Причина возникновения Способ устранения
#ДЕЛ/0! Деление числа на ноль или пустую ячейку Использовать функцию ЕСЛИОШИБКА или проверить знаменатель
#ЗНАЧ! В формуле участвует текст вместо числа Очистить данные, удалить пробелы, проверить формат ячеек
##### Ячейка слишком узкая для отображения числа Расширить столбец двойным кликом по границе заголовка
#ССЫЛКА! Удалена ячейка, на которую вела ссылка Восстановить удаленные данные или исправить формулу

⚠️ Внимание: Функция ЕСЛИОШИБКА скрывает все типы ошибок, включая те, которые могли возникнуть из-за опечатки в формуле. Используйте её осторожно, чтобы не пропустить логические mistakes в расчетах.

Расчет процентов в сводных таблицах

Для больших массивов данных использование обычных формул может быть неудобным. Сводные таблицы (Pivot Tables) позволяют быстро агрегировать данные и отображать их в процентах без создания дополнительных столбцов с формулами. Это особенно актуально при анализе продаж, где нужно видеть долю каждого товара в общем обороте.

Чтобы активировать этот режим, добавьте поле с числовыми данными в область «Значения» сводной таблицы. Затем кликните правой кнопкой мыши по любому числу в этой области, выберите «Дополнительные вычисления» и нажмите «% от общей суммы». Программа автоматически пересчитает все значения, показав их вклад в итог.

Гибкость сводных таблиц позволяет менять контекст расчета. Можно выбрать отображение процентов от суммы по столбцу, от суммы по строке или от родительской категории. Это дает возможность проводить многоуровневый анализ структуры данных, что невозможно сделать одной простой формулой деления.

📊 Какой метод расчета процентов вы используете чаще?
Простая формула деления с форматированием:Функция ЕСЛИОШИБКА для защиты от нулей:Сводные таблицы для анализа больших данных:Макросы или VBA для автоматизации:

Продвинутые техники визуализации долей

Сухие цифры процентов часто трудно воспринимать визуально, особенно когда нужно быстро оценить ситуацию. Встроенные инструменты условного форматирования позволяют превратить столбец с процентами в наглядную диаграмму. Выберите диапазон с расчетами, перейдите в меню «Главная» -> «Условное форматирование» -> «Гистограммы».

Цветовые шкалы также отлично подходят для отображения доли. Градиент от красного (низкий процент) к зеленому (высокий процент) мгновенно выделяет лидеров и аутсайдеров. Настройка правил форматирования позволяет задать пороговые значения, при которых цвет ячейки будет меняться, например, если доля падает ниже 10%.

Для презентаций и отчетов можно использовать элемент «Спарклайны» (Sparklines). Это мини-диаграммы, которые встраиваются прямо в ячейку рядом с числом. Они не требуют создания отдельных графиков на листе и позволяют отслеживать динамику изменения процента во времени в компактном виде.

Визуализация не должна заменять точные числа. Всегда оставляйте возможность увидеть числовое значение, наводя курсор на ячейку или добавляя подписи данных. Сочетание цветовой индикации и точных цифр обеспечивает наилучшее понимание данных аудиторией.

Часто задаваемые вопросы (FAQ)

Как посчитать процент от числа, а не долю?

Если вам нужно найти, сколько составляет 20% от 500 (то есть умножение), используйте формулу =500*20% или =500*0,2. В случае ссылки на ячейку с процентом A1 и числом B1, формула будет =B1*A1.

Почему при суммировании процентов получается не 100%?

Это происходит из-за округления отображаемых значений. Если 33,33% + 33,33% + 33,34%, сумма будет 100%, но при округлении до целых (33+33+33) получится 99%. Для отчетов используйте функцию ОКРУГЛ или увеличьте разрядность.

Можно ли вычитать проценты в Excel?

Да, можно. Если из цены 1000 руб. нужно вычесть 20%, формула будет =1000*(1-20%) или =1000*(1-0,2). Программа сначала выполнит вычитание в скобках, а затем умножение.

Как быстро применить процентный формат к столбцу?

Выделите столбец и нажмите сочетание клавиш Ctrl+Shift+%. Это мгновенно применит форматирование. Также можно использовать кнопку «%» в группе «Число» на вкладке «Главная».